WHAT YOULL DO

  • Responsible for the billing and reconciliation of some of the management companys largest revenue streams. This will include following GAAP revenue recognition policies performing the calculation of fees and writing variance analysis that is presented to the executive team quarterly.
  • Record and analyze changes in payroll-related expenses the largest expense driver within the company for 150 entities with differing ownership structures.
  • Prepare account reconciliations for a variety of accounting areas ranging from routine ones that are applicable across most companies (e.g. fixed assets debt prepaids) and complex ones that will sharpen your technical prowess (e.g. intangibles derivatives & hedges intercompany transactions).
  • Collaborate with internal departments by gathering relevant business and financial operations information to achieve Corporate accounting goals.
  • Embrace the professional opportunities of working at a public company. This includes preparing financial disclosures timely to meet SEC filing deadlines and adhering to SOX-compliant processes.
  • Lead special projects or complete other tasks as needed.

WHAT YOULL NEED TO SUCCEED (REQUIREMENTS)

  • Bachelors degree in Accounting required
  • 2 years of related accounting experience
  • CPA or active candidate is preferred
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ills and strong computer skills
  • Public accounting or real estate/REIT experience are pluses
